Can beef and black tea be consumed together?
Generally speaking, beef and black tea can be consumed together, but it should be done in moderation. A detailed explanation is as follows:
Beef is rich in protein, fat, B-complex vitamins, folic acid, calcium, phosphorus, iron, and other trace elements. It has benefits such as nourishing the stomach, promoting recovery, and aiding in weight loss. Black tea contains beta-carotene, vitamins, amino acids, polyphenolic compounds, caffeine, and other substances. Consumed in moderation, it can help refresh the mind, provide antioxidant effects, promote diuresis and reduce swelling, and aid digestion. When consumed together, these two foods can supply various nutrients required by the body without causing adverse reactions. During cooking, such as stewing beef, an appropriate amount of black tea can be added. This not only shortens the cooking time but also makes the beef more tender and flavorful. Additionally, black tea can help remove fishy odors and enhance color.
Most people can consume them together in moderation without any problem; however, certain individuals should pay attention to dietary combinations and consume them in moderation. Maintaining a balanced and diverse diet in daily life contributes to promoting overall health.
